Initiating a Hermes Return Request:

The first step in arranging a Hermes return is to initiate a return request. This is usually done through the online portal of the retailer from whom you purchased the item. The process typically involves:

1. Accessing the Returns Portal: Navigate to the retailer's website and locate their returns or customer service section. This is usually found in the footer or a dedicated help section.

2. Providing Order Information: You'll need your order number, email address associated with the order, and potentially other identifying information.

3. Selecting a Return Reason: The retailer will likely ask you to select a reason for your return (e.g., incorrect size, damaged item, unwanted item). Be as accurate and concise as possible.

4. Choosing a Return Method: Here's where you'll select the courier return option. You should see options for FedEx and/or UPS, depending on the retailer's agreements with Hermes. Choosing this option will usually generate a prepaid return label or instructions on how to obtain one.

5. Generating the Return Label (or receiving instructions): Once you've selected the courier option, the system will either generate a printable return label immediately or provide instructions on how to access and print it. This label is crucial for the courier to process your return correctly.

How to Print a Hermes Return Label:

The return label, often a barcode, is essential for your package to be processed efficiently. Once generated, you'll typically be able to:

1. Download the Label: Most systems allow you to download the label as a PDF file. Ensure you save it to a location you can easily access.

2. Print the Label: Print the label on a standard printer using high-quality paper. Ensure the barcode is clear and legible. Do not use a damaged or blurry label.

3. Attach the Label: Carefully attach the printed label to the outside of your package, covering any previous labels or markings. Make sure it's securely affixed to avoid damage or loss during transit.

Hermes Prepaid Returns:

Many Hermes returns utilize a prepaid return system. This means the retailer has already covered the cost of shipping the return. You won't need to pay any additional fees at the drop-off location. However, always double-check the instructions provided to confirm that your return is indeed prepaid. If you are unsure, contact the retailer's customer service before proceeding.
